You can start out with something like the Aquatic Life RO Buddie. You will want to monitor the tap water coming in vs the purified water going out of the RO unit. So, pair it with a Dual TDS Monitor & you are set. I would also pick up a float kit and install it in 32g brute container. Don't know how many time I flooded the garage before I learned my lesson.
I have my RO mounted to a small piece of plywood hanging in the garage for easy maintenance. Grab another 32g Brute container for mixing the salt and a small pump to transfer the water.
It was a bit overwhelming at 1st, but sure beats the days of going to a LFS for water.
